A Step-by-Step Guide: How to Get a Medical Marijuana Card in Alabama in 2024
In 2024, Alabama joined the growing number of states legalizing medical marijuana, offering patients access to alternative treatments for various health conditions. If you’re a resident of Alabama and interested in obtaining a medical marijuana card, you’ll need to follow a specific process outlined by the state. Here’s a comprehensive guide on how to get a medical marijuana card in Alabama in 2024:
Understand Eligibility Criteria: Alabama has set specific criteria for individuals eligible to obtain a medical marijuana card. Generally, patients suffering from qualifying medical conditions such as chronic pain, epilepsy, cancer, PTSD, or terminal illnesses may qualify. Make sure your condition meets the state’s requirements.
Consult with a Qualified Physician: Schedule an appointment with a licensed physician in Alabama who is registered with the Alabama Medical Cannabis Commission (AMCC). During your consultation, discuss your medical condition and whether medical marijuana could be a suitable treatment option for you.
Obtain Medical Records: Gather relevant medical records and documentation supporting your diagnosis and treatment history. These records will help the physician evaluate your eligibility for a medical marijuana card.
Receive Physician Recommendation: If the physician determines that you qualify for medical marijuana treatment, they will provide you with a written recommendation. This recommendation is a crucial step in the application process.
Register with the AMCC: Visit the official website of the Alabama Medical Cannabis Commission to register as a patient. Complete the registration process by providing personal information and uploading the physician’s recommendation along with your medical records.
Pay Application Fee: Alabama requires patients to pay a fee for their medical marijuana card application. Ensure you have the necessary funds to cover the application fee, which may vary depending on the state’s regulations.
Wait for Approval: Once you’ve submitted your application and paid the fee, the AMCC will review your submission. Be patient during this waiting period, as processing times may vary.
Receive Medical Marijuana Card: Upon approval, you will receive your medical marijuana card by mail. This card allows you to purchase medical cannabis from licensed dispensaries in Alabama.
Renew Your Card: Medical marijuana cards in Alabama are typically valid for a specified period, after which they must be renewed. Keep track of your card’s expiration date and initiate the renewal process in advance to ensure uninterrupted access to medical cannabis.
Explore Dispensary Options: With your medical marijuana card in hand, you can visit authorized dispensaries in Alabama to purchase medical cannabis products. Familiarize yourself with the available products and consult with dispensary staff to find the right options for your needs.
